Course Overview

Offered by Norwich University of the Arts, the BA (Hons) Illustration (with Integrated Foundation Year) with Diploma in Creative Professional Development provides a comprehensive undergraduate education in creative arts and design. Based in Norwich, England, this programme combines theoretical knowledge with practical application, with a 5-year full-time structure. OVERVIEW Illustration at Norwich University of the Arts is a forward-facing contemporary degree that values and nurtures individuality and has a reputation for challenging conventional thinking. At the heart of our highly regarded course is the power of illustration to communicate, be it through telling stories with different media from the page to the screen, or in a diverse range of creative applications including those which value sustainable, ethical practices and champion inclusivity. International tuition fees are £18,860 per year, home/UK fees are £9,790 per year, and a minimum IELTS score of 6.0 is required for admission. Graduates from this programme benefit from strong career prospects, with 88% student satisfaction rating, a median graduate salary of £19,500 within three years, and a 90% continuation rate.
